#A96800 Hex Color Code

#A96800

The Hexadecimal Color #A96800 is a contrast shade of Dark Goldenrod. #A96800 RGB value is rgb(169, 104, 0). RGB Color Model of #A96800 consists of 66% red, 40% green and 0% blue. HSL color Mode of #A96800 has 37°(degrees) Hue, 100% Saturation and 33% Lightness. #A96800 color has an wavelength of 596.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A96800 is #CC9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A96800 is #A60. The Closest Color to #A96800 is #B8860B. Official Name of #A96800 Hex Code is Mai Tai.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A96800 is 0 Cyan 38 Magenta 100 Yellow 34 Black and #A96800 CMY is 0, 38, 100.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A96800 is hsl(37,100,33,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(37, 100, 66).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A96800 is 21.31, 18.34, 2.42.
Hex8 Value of #A96800 is #A96800FF. Decimal Value of #A96800 is 11102208 and Octal Value of #A96800 is 52264000. Binary Value of #A96800 is 10101001, 1101000, 0 and Android of #A96800 is 4289292288 / 0xffa96800.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A96800 is 0.507, 0.436, 0.436 and YIQ Color Space of #A96800 is 111.579, 72.1487, -18.6173.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A96800 is 23.1, 16.15, 2.69.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A96800 is 49.91, 19.67, 57.4.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A96800 is 49.91, 53.76, 48.79.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A96800 is 49.91, 60.68, 71.08. Hunter Lab variable of #A96800 is 42.83, 13.88, 26.63.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A96800

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
